El Toro Market Hours of Operation and Locations in Water Valley, MS
- 1 Locations in Water Valley
- El Toro Market Hours
- Category: Grocery & Market
-
1006 central stView Store Details
(662) 473-4432
Explore Water ValleyView More
- Apparel H & MSuper Dollar